Compresión y descompresión de archivos zip, gz y bz2

Compresión y descompresión de archivos zip, gz y bz2

Descarga: compresion_y_descompresion.zip. Mediante los módulos integrados por defecto zipfile, gzip y bz2 Python nos permite realizar compresiones y descompresiones con los diversos algoritmos. zipfile Este módulo provee herramientas para crear, escribir, leer, añadir y listar un archivo ZIP. Cualquier uso avanzado del mismo requerirá del entendimiento del formato, definido en la PKZIP Application Note. El… Seguir leyendo

Minimizar/comprimir archivos JS y CSS

Minimizar/comprimir archivos JS y CSS

Descarga: comprimir-css-y-js.zip (incluye YUI Compressor 2.4.8 y el script de Python). Al momento de desarrollar aplicaciones web, vía CGI o WSGI, con Django, web2py, Pyramid o cualquiera fuese la librería, incluso páginas estáticas o en otros lenguajes de programación, comprimir archivos estáticos o que no cambian muy a menudo su contenido es una buena práctica… Seguir leyendo

smaz – Compresor ASCII para pequeños textos

Los algoritmos convencionales de comprensión de datos son eficientes cuando de grandes cantidades se trata; pero, ¿qué hay de pequeños textos? Por ejemplo, mensajes los cuales queremos reducir su tamaño para enviarlos a través de una conexión TCP, o simplemente al momento de almacenarlos. >>> import zlib >>> a = "https://www.recursospython.com/" >>> b = zlib.compress(a)… Seguir leyendo